Ruby Daniels Nangala
Pintupi/Luritja, (b.c.1961)
Mothers Story 2008
Acrylic on Belgian linen
Ruby inherited her mother, Linda Syddick's dreaming and stories. This painting tells a true story that happened at Haast's Bluff in 1945. Linda camped with some other people next to the windmill. One of the companions explained to them that it as for bringing water out of the ground. Later that night they were joined by an old 'witchdoctor' and his two wives. In the morning he panicked at the sight of the windmill, which he thought was a devil. He tried throwing spears and magic rocks at the windmill but they were deflected and did nothing to destroy it. The others tried to explain to him that it was for water, and they did eventually convince him that it was harmless
